文档详情

单片机原理及应用考试试卷及答案..doc

发布:2017-01-19约4.81千字共6页下载文档
文本预览下载声明
一.填空题: 1.8051系列单片机字长是 8 位,有 40 根引脚。当系统扩展外部存储器或扩展I/O口时, P0 口作地址低8位和数据传送总线, P2 口作地址总线高8位输出, P3 口的相应引脚会输出控制信号。 2.当为低电平(接地)时,CPU只执行 外部程序存储器或ROM 中的程序。 3.数据指针DPTR有 16 位,程序计数器PC有 16 位。 4.在MCS-51单片机中,一个机器周期包括 12 个时钟周期。 5.C51编译器支持三种存储模式,其中SMALL模式默认的存储类型为 data ,LARGE模式默认的存储类型为 xdata 。 6.欲使P1口的低4位输出0,高4位不变,应执行一条 ANL P1,#0F0H 命令。 7.8051单片机复位后,PC = 0000H 。 8. 74LS138是具有3个输入的译码器芯片,用其输出作片选信号,最多可在 8 块芯片中选中其中任一块。 9.单片机位寻址区的单元地址是从 20H 单元到 2FH 单元,若某位地址是12H,它所在单元的地址应该是 22H 10.MOV A,30H 指令对于源操作数的寻址方式是 直接 寻址。 11.在MCS-51单片机中,寄存器间接寻址用到的寄存器只能是通用寄存器R0、R1和 DPTR 。 12..程序状态字PSW中的RS1和RS0的作用是 选择工作寄存器组 13.8051单片机,当CPU响应某中断请求时,将会自动转向相应规定地址(即中断入口地址)去执行,外部中断0入口地址为: 0003 H,T1入口地址为 0018 H。 14.变量的指针就是 变量的地址 。对于变量a,如果它所对应的内存单元地址为2000H,它的指针是 2000H 。 15.特殊功能寄存器中,单元地址( )的特殊功能寄存器,可以位寻址。 16.interrupt m 是C51函数中非常重要的一个修饰符,这是因为 中断 函数必须通过它进行修饰。 17.Using n用于指定本函数内部使用的 寄存器组 ,n的取值为 0~3 。 18.消除按键盘抖动通常有两种方法: 硬件消抖 和 软件消抖 。 二、 选择题 1、访问外部数据存储器时,不起作用的信号是( C )。 (A) (B) (C) (D)ALE 2、若开机复位后,CPU使用的是寄存器第一组,地址范围是( D )。 A、00H-10H B、00H-07H C、10H-1FH D、08H-0FH 3.MCS-51单片机的位寻址区位于内部RAM的( D )单元。 A. 00H—7FH B. 20H—7FH C. 00H—1FH D. 20H—2FH 4.访问片外数据存储器的寻址方式是( C )。 A、立即寻址 B、寄存器寻址 C、寄存器间接寻址 D、直接寻址 5.当需要从MCS-51单片机程序存储器取数据时,采用的指令为( B )。 A. MOV A, @R1 B. MOVC A, @A + DPTR C. MOVX A, @ R0 D. MOVX A, @ DPTR 6.在MCS-51中,需要外加电路实现中断撤除的是:( A ) (A) 电平方式的外部中断 (B) 脉冲方式的外部中断 (C) 外部串行中断 (D) 定时中断 7.在存储器扩展电路中74LS373的主要功能是 ( D ) A.存储数据 B.存储地址 C.锁存数据 D.锁存地址 8.ADC 0809芯片是m路模拟输入的n位A/D转换器,m、n是 ( A ) A.8、8 B.8、9 C.8、16 D.1、8 9.8051
显示全部
相似文档